    Default Boxing classes

    I was wondering if anyone on here does it. I've been taking classes for a couple of weeks now and love it, i'm seriously considering doing actual fights. Any tip on different exercises i could at home, i got some my off my trainer to do but a few more wouldn't hurt.

    yea ive been boxing for a couple of years .. skipping skipping and more skipping lol... really helps out with your footwork .and also you can hit the heavy bag and mits all day but it will never hit you back you really need to get into the ring and spa with as many different people as you can and as often as you can if you wanna compete. when your at home practice your footwork and getting the proper technique down.
    and keep up the road work and cardio moring or afternoon runs try not to just do a steady pace but a intermediate bursts

    lol i never liked running much but its something ya gonna have to get into lol give it a good 4-6 months of getting fit and learning before having a proper spa .. once you get in the ring you really relize how long 3 min goes for when a bloke is trying to hit you around the ring there is fit and then theres ring fit
